The effect of hyperbaric oxygenation therapy on myocardial function

Hyperbaric oxygenation therapy is successfully implemented for the treatment of several disorders. Data on the effect of hyperbaric oxygenation on echocardiographic parameters in asymptomatic patients is limited. The current study sought to evaluate the effect of hyperbaric oxygenation therapy on echocardiographic parameters in asymptomatic patients. Thirty-one consecutive patients underwent a 60-sessions course of hyperbaric oxygenation therapy in an attempt to improve cognitive impairment. In all subjects, echocardiography examination was performed before and after a course of hyperbaric oxygenation therapy. Conventional and speckle tracking imaging parameters were calculated and analyzed. The mean age was 70 +/- 9.5 years, 28 [90%] were males. History of coronary artery disease was present in 12 [39%]. 94% suffered from hypertension, 42% had diabetes mellitus. Baseline wall motion abnormalities were found in eight patients, however, global ejection fraction was within normal limits. During the study, ejection fraction [EF], increased from 60.71 +/- 6.02 to 62.29 +/- 5.19%, p = 0.02. Left ventricular end systolic volume [LVESV], decreased from 38.08 +/- 13.30 to 35.39 +/- 13.32 ml, p = 0.01. Myocardial performance index [MPi] improved, from 0.29 +/- 0.07 to 0.26 +/- 0.08, p = 0.03. Left ventricular [LV] global longitudinal strain increased from - 19.31 +/- 3.17% to - 20.16 +/- 3.34%, p = 0.036 due to improvement in regional strain in the apical and antero-septal segments. Twist increased from 18.32 +/- 6.61 degrees to 23.12 +/- 6.35 degrees p = 0.01, due to improvement in the apical rotation, from 11.76 +/- 4.40 degrees to 16.10 +/- 5.56 degrees, p = 0.004. Hyperbaric oxygen therapy appears to improve left ventricular function, especially in the apical segments, and is associated with better cardiac performance. If our results are confirmed in further studies, HBOT can be used in many patients with heart failure and systolic dysfunction.
